The 2019 Fiji Football Cup (FF Cup) was the 29th edition of FF Cup. The tournament started with the eight participants from the 2019 Fiji Premier League. The tournament was won by Nadi who defeated Suva in the final by 2-1.

Teams

The eight teams from 2019 Fiji Premier League participated in the 2019 FF Cup.

Group stage

The 8 teams were split in two groups with four teams each. The top two advanced to semifinal.
